Heiko Hickstein is a scholar working on Surgery, Nephrology and Hepatology. According to data from OpenAlex, Heiko Hickstein has authored 24 papers receiving a total of 929 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Surgery, 7 papers in Nephrology and 5 papers in Hepatology. Recurrent topics in Heiko Hickstein’s work include Liver Disease and Transplantation (5 papers), Dialysis and Renal Disease Management (4 papers) and Hemodynamic Monitoring and Therapy (4 papers). Heiko Hickstein is often cited by papers focused on Liver Disease and Transplantation (5 papers), Dialysis and Renal Disease Management (4 papers) and Hemodynamic Monitoring and Therapy (4 papers). Heiko Hickstein coll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and Vietnam. Heiko Hickstein's co-authors include Steffen Mitzner, Jan Stange, Reinhard Schmidt, Sebastian Klammt, G Korten, P Peszynski, Elke D. Berger, Jörg Emmrich, Stefan Liebe and Christiane M. Erley and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Antimicrobial Agents and Chemotherapy and Critical Care.
